TITLE: Decatur Township Director of Special Education REPORTS TO: Assistant Superintendent of Schools EMPLOYMENT STATUS: 220-Day Contract SALARY: Commensurate with Experience LOCATION: Decatur Township Central Office Job Description The Director of Special Education will oversee and enhance the special education programs, Section 504 plans within MSD Decatur Township. This position requires a dynamic and experienced leader who can develop and drive strategic initiatives, ensure high-quality programming, and promote an environment of academic excellence and inclusivity. The Director of Special Education will collaborate with the Learning Support Team, special education coordinators, school leaders, teachers, parents, students, and community stakeholders to align special services with the district’s mission, goals, and strategic priorities. Qualifications Master’s Degree or higher required Director of Exceptional Learners license or willingness to work toward licensure Exemplary verbal and written communication skills required Ability to use and utilize technology required Skills and Knowledge Proven leadership and the ability to supervise Ability to problem-solve Understanding and knowledge of all operational functions of a school district Able to organize and manage multiple projects simultaneously Proficient written and verbal communication skills Excellent attendance record Strong employee relations skills Essential Functions Oversees the implementation of special education services. Oversees the implementation of Section 504 plans. Serves as Manifestation Determination Facilitator for special education and Section 504 conferences. Attends staffings and case conferences as needed. Provide support to K-12 Behavior Support, Life Skills Program, Mild Program (secondary only), and Structured Teach programs and assist special education coordinators as appropriate. Collaborates with RISE Learning Center as a separate school placement option. Supervises and complies with grants for Part B, and Medicaid reimbursements, writes grants, review and sign all programmatic and fiscal reports, coordinate with business office; manage compliance through work with non-pubs, stays up-to-date on grant cycles, writes amendments, communicate with Assistant Superintendent, school administrators, and teachers as needed. Reviews Results-Driven Accountability data and implements necessary changes within the district to drive strategy and improve student outcomes. Develop partnerships with outside agencies in order to provide opportunities for students with special needs. Ensures compliance with Federal and State Special Education Laws and oversees the implementation of all policies and procedures including gathering data for and filing of state and federal reports. Coordinate with the transportation department to discuss needs and concerns for special education students. Keeps informed of the multiple and complex legal requirements governing special education and assures compliance within the policies, procedures, and programs for special education. Conducts periodic reviews of enrollment, programming options, and important trends in education in an effort to advise the Assistant Superintendent of programing changes. Assures that procedures are in effect which locate, evaluate, and provide students with disabilities a free and appropriate education in the least restrictive environment. Provides leadership in establishing new programs and developing improved understanding of existing programs. Provides leadership in due process procedures in accordance with statutory requirements. Determines staff development needs and provides/coordinates in-service to special education/general education, administrators, and parents as needed; coordinates training for administrators and staff on compliance with Indiana’s Article 7, IDEA, and Section 504. Conducts regular assessments of Section 504 plans and ensures staff are trained to complete and implement plans at each school. Coordinates with the Special Education Leadership Team to conduct yearly professional development for special education staff on updates in special education and best practices for IEPs. Coordinates with the Special Education Leadership Team to conduct yearly professional development for instructional assistants and bus drivers. Communicates proactively with parents. Distributes monthly communication with special education and administrative staff. Make positive contributions to the culture and climate of the MSD of Decatur Township. Supports the MTSS process K-12. Supports building administrators on student discipline in collaboration with the Directors of Elementary and Secondary Education. Oversees the implementation of Developmental PreK in collaboration with the Principal at Lynwood Elementary. Maintains confidentiality of information. Performs such other tasks and assumes such other responsibilities as the Superintendent or his or her designee may assign. Leadership Responsibilities Provides direct leadership, support and evaluation for: Special Services Administrative Assistant Special Education Coordinators (2) DHH Special Education Teacher Speech and Language Pathologist Coordinator Speech and Language Pathologists Occupational Therapist Coordinator Occupational and Physical Therapists School Psychologists Other Duties and Responsibilities Use creative and collaborative problem-solving to accomplish goals. Facilitates grant‑writing. Support MSD of Decatur Township decisions and direction relevant to matters of policy.
